当前位置:首页 » 编程软件 » 代码是否能进行编译

代码是否能进行编译

发布时间: 2025-03-13 16:48:12

㈠ 编写好c语言源程序后如何进行编译和运行

编写好C语言源程序后,需要按照以下步骤进行编译和运行
1. 保存源代码文件,确保文件扩展名为“.c”。
2. 使用C语言编译器将源代码文件编译成目标文件。在命令行中输入“gcc 源文件名.c -o 目标文件名”即可进行编译。如果编译成功,将生成一个目标文件。
3. 将目标文件链接成可执行文件。在命令行中输入“gcc 目标文件名.o -o 执行文件名”即可进行链接。如桐弊陵果链接成功卜败,将生成一个可执行文件。
4. 运行可执行文件。在命令行中输入“./执行文件名”即可运行程序。如果一切正常,程序将输出预期的结果。
需要注意的是,编译和运行C语言程序需要相应的环境配置,包括C语言编译器和操作系统等。此外,不同的操作系统和编译器可能具有不同的命令行语法和选项,因此需要根据实际情况进行调局戚整。

㈡ 为什么visual c++的源文件不能编译,以前可以的,现在正确的代码都不能

或许你曾经更改过cmd.exe的位置?这可能会导致某些环境变量出现问题,进而影响到系统命令的查找。然而,这与Visual C++编译器的问题似乎无关。长久以来,Visual C++的源文件能够成功编译,但现在即便是正确的代码也无法通过编译了。

这可能与Visual Studio的更新有关。随着软件的不断更新,某些编译器设置或库文件可能会发生变化,导致原有的编译设置不再适用。此外,一些新的安全措施或优化选项可能会引入新的限制。

在排查问题时,检查环境变量和编译器设置是非常重要的。确保你的系统环境变量正确无误,特别是在安装或更新Visual Studio之后。同时,检查编译器设置,确保它们与当前项目兼容。一些可能的设置变更包括编译器版本、预处理器定义、链接器选项等。

此外,确保你使用的是最新版本的Visual C++库文件。这些库文件可能包含新的API或改进,而旧的代码可能不支持这些更新。你还可以尝试清除编译缓存,这有助于解决一些临时性的问题。

如果上述方法都无法解决问题,可能需要检查代码本身是否存在潜在的错误。有时候,即使是正确的代码,也可能因为细微的语法错误或不兼容的特性而无法编译。仔细审查代码,确保所有语法和结构都符合最新的编译规则。

值得注意的是,Visual Studio本身也经历了多次重大更新。每个版本都可能引入新的功能或改进,但也可能带来一些兼容性问题。确保你的开发环境与项目的编译需求保持一致,可以有效避免此类问题。

㈢ 开发一个c语言程序要经过哪四个步骤

开发一个C语言程序需要经过的四个步骤:编辑、编译、连接、运行。

C语言程序可以使用在任意架构的处理器上,只要那种架构的处理器具有对应的C语言编译器和库,然后将C源代码编译、连接成目标二进制文件之后即可运行。

1、预处理:输入源程序并保存(.C文件)。

2、编译:将源程序翻译为目标文件(.OBJ文件)。

3、链接:将目标文件生成可执行文件(.EXE文件)。

4、运行:执行.EXE文件,得到运行结果。

/iknow-pic.cdn.bcebos.com/472309f790529822853c356fd9ca7bcb0a46d40b"target="_blank"title="点击查看大图"class="illustration_alink">/iknow-pic.cdn.bcebos.com/472309f790529822853c356fd9ca7bcb0a46d40b?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_600%2Ch_800%2Climit_1%2Fquality%2Cq_85%2Fformat%2Cf_auto"esrc="https://iknow-pic.cdn.bcebos.com/472309f790529822853c356fd9ca7bcb0a46d40b"/>

(3)代码是否能进行编译扩展阅读:

C语言代码变为程序的几个阶段:

1、首先是源代码文件test.c和相关的头文件,如stdio.h等被预处理器cpp预处理成一个.i文件。经过预编译后的.i文件不包含任何宏定义,因为所有的宏已经被展开,并且包含的文件也已经被插入到.i文件中。

2、编译过程就是把预处理完的文件进行一系列的词法分析、语法分析、语义分析以及优化后产生相应的汇编代码文件,这个过程往往是我们所说的整个程序的构建的核心部分,也是最复杂的部分之一。

3、汇编器不直接输出可执行文件而是输出一个目标文件,汇编器可以调用ld产生一个能够运行的可执行程序。即需要将一大堆文件链接起来才可以得到“a.out”,即最终的可执行文件。

4、在链接过程中,对其他定义在目标文件中的函数调用的指令需要被重新调整,对实用其他定义在其他目标文件的变量来说,也存在同样问题。

参考资料来源:/ke..com/item/c语言/105958?fr=aladdin"target="_blank"title="网络-c语言">网络-c语言

㈣ c语言代码怎么运行

要运行C语言代码,需要完成以下步骤:
安装C语言编译器:C语言需要使用编译器进行编译,生成可执行文件。常见的C语言编译器有GCC、Clang等,可以在官方网站下载并安装。
编写C语言代码:使用任何文本编辑器,比如Notepad++、Sublime Text、Visual Studio等,编写C语言代码。代码保存时需要使用以.c为后缀名的文件名。
编译代码:使用命令行或者集成开发环境(IDE)进行编译。命令行中使用gcc或者clang命令进行编译,比如gcc main.c -o output。这个命令将会编译main.c文件并生成可执行文件output。IDE会自动完成编译工作,只需要点击编译按钮即可。
运行可执行文件:编译成功后,使用命令行或者文件管理器打开可执行文件所在的目录,输入可执行文件的名称并按下回车键即可运行程序。比如./output(Linux/MacOS系统)或者output.exe(Windows系统)。
需要注意的是,C语言代码的编译和运行过程可能因不同的操作系统、编译器、编辑器而有所不同。因此在编写和运行C语言代码时,需要根据实际情况进行相应的调整。

热点内容
loggerjava 发布:2025-03-13 19:54:36 浏览:708
android标题栏隐藏 发布:2025-03-13 19:54:35 浏览:677
企业网站数据库设计 发布:2025-03-13 19:48:18 浏览:465
绝对素数c语言 发布:2025-03-13 19:48:16 浏览:788
java工程师简历 发布:2025-03-13 19:42:33 浏览:456
我的世界2b2t服务器海上农场 发布:2025-03-13 19:25:33 浏览:993
人工智能安卓主板哪个好 发布:2025-03-13 19:15:16 浏览:237
android系统程序 发布:2025-03-13 19:12:15 浏览:37
如何修改乐视账号密码 发布:2025-03-13 18:56:12 浏览:971
c编程书籍 发布:2025-03-13 18:51:49 浏览:450